WATCH: Shadrack Sibiya placed on leave amid Mkhwanazi claims
Updated | By Tamasha Khanyi
Deputy National Police Commissioner Shadrack Sibiya has been asked to take a leave of absence.

Sibiya, who is in charge of crime detection, is one of the senior police officials named by KZN police chief Nhlanhla Mkhwanazi as having interfered in investigations into organised crime syndicates, among other claims.

National Police Commissioner Fannie Masemola says Sibiya's leave is to allow investigations into the allegations.

Commissioner Masemola on Tuesday afternoon received memorandum of demands from local civil society groups in Durban who took part in a march in support of provincial police commissioner Nhlanhla Mkhwanazi.
